February 2003: Morganna Davies


Interview by Moondancer
moondancer@nemedcuculatii.org



Morganna Davies, an Alexandrian Priestess, was a member of one of the earliest Alexandrian covens in the United States and founder of the Keepers of the Ancient Mysteries (.K.A.M.). She is also a Priestess of the New England Covens of Traditionalist Witches (N.E.C.T.W.). Morganna has practiced and taught the Craft for over thirty years. She is certified in Reiki and flower essence therapy. Her storytelling is well known, and her recording of Fairy Gifts: Celtic Folk Tales, was released in 1998. She is co-author, with Aradia Lynch, of Keepers of the Flame - Interviews With Elders of Traditional Witchcraft, published in 2001.
